What items are not allowed in my carry-on luggage?
    1. Liquids over 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).
    2. Sharp objects (e.g., knives, scissors).
    3. Flammable items (e.g., lighter fluid, fireworks).
    4. Sporting goods (e.g., baseball bats, ski poles).
    5. Tools (e.g., hammers, wrenches).
Check TSA Guidelines: Refer to the TSA or your country’s aviation security website for a complete list of prohibited items.
What do I need to bring to check-in at the airport?
Domestic Flights:
    1. Government-issued photo ID (e.g., driver’s license, passport).
    2. Boarding pass (either printed or digital).
International Flights:
    1. Valid passport.
    2. Visa (if required for your destination)
    3. Boarding pass.
Additional Documents: Any other documentation required by the destination country or your airline.

Basic Information About Airports in Acadiana Rgnl (ARA)

Acadiana Regional Airport (ARA) is a small yet efficient airport located in New Iberia, Louisiana. It serves as a gateway to the vibrant culture and rich history of the Acadiana region. With its single runway and modern terminal, ARA is designed to provide a hassle-free travel experience. The airport primarily caters to regional flights, making it a convenient choice for both business and leisure travelers.

Basic Airport Facilities and Services in Acadiana Rgnl (ARA)

Acadiana Regional Airport offers a range of facilities to enhance your travel experience. The terminal features comfortable seating areas, free Wi-Fi, and a small café where you can grab a bite before your flight. There are also rental car services available, making it easy to explore the surrounding area upon arrival. The airport is designed to be user-friendly, ensuring that you have everything you need for a smooth journey.

Public Transportation Options at Airports in Acadiana Rgnl (ARA)

While ARA is a smaller airport, there are still several public transportation options available. Local taxi services and rideshare apps like Uber and Lyft operate in the area, providing convenient door-to-door service. Additionally, some hotels in the region offer shuttle services to and from the airport, making it easy to get to your accommodation without any hassle.
